Andalusia Labs is an applied research lab building internet-native economic infrastructure. The lab develops AI-augmented tools and programmable GDP infrastructure, staffed by researchers and engineers from major technology and financial companies.

Company profile
researched Aug 2026Andalusia Labs is a research and engineering company building economic infrastructure intended for global markets. The company positions its work at the intersection of security, privacy, and machine intelligence for autonomous programs, describing its overall focus as internet-native economic infrastructure.
The company characterizes itself as being at an early stage of development and is actively recruiting. Its team members state prior experience shipping AI and financial infrastructure at Google, Coinbase, Goldman Sachs, and quantitative trading firms.

Latest developments
Andalusia Labs lists individual backers including Naval Ravikant (founder, AngelList), Napoleon Ta (partner, Founders Fund), and Noah Jessop (partner, Proof Group), alongside additional unnamed investors described as coming from companies including Google and Apple.
